Famous Italian Actors

Italian cinema boasts a rich history filled with talented actors who have made significant contributions to the film industry. Here are a few of the most famous Italian actors:

  • Roberto Benigni - Known for his Academy Award-winning film "Life is Beautiful," Benigni's unique blend of humor and emotion has resonated with audiences worldwide.
  • Monica Bellucci - A leading lady in both Italian and international films, her roles in "Malèna" and "The Matrix" series have solidified her status as an icon.
  • Marcello Mastroianni - Renowned for his roles in films such as "La Dolce Vita," Mastroianni is celebrated for his contributions to Italian neorealism.
  • Sophia Loren - A timeless beauty and a powerhouse actress, Loren has won numerous awards and is known for films like "Two Women."

Influential Italian Musicians

Italy’s influence on music is profound, with several artists gaining international acclaim. Some notable musicians include:

  • Andrea Bocelli - A tenor whose powerful voice has captivated audiences around the globe, Bocelli's crossover appeal between classical and pop music is unmatched.
  • Luciano Pavarotti - One of the "Three Tenors," Pavarotti remains a symbol of opera excellence, known for his charismatic performances and humanitarian efforts.
  • Eros Ramazzotti - A pop singer-songwriter, Ramazzotti's romantic ballads have made him a household name in Italy and beyond.

Iconic Italian Fashion Designers

Italy is home to some of the most legendary fashion designers in the world. Their creativity and innovation have set trends and defined styles. Key figures include:

  • Giorgio Armani - A pioneer of modern tailoring, Armani is renowned for his elegant designs that have shaped the fashion landscape.
  • Domenico Dolce and Stefano Gabbana - The dynamic duo behind Dolce & Gabbana, their bold designs celebrate Italian culture and femininity.
  • Valentino Garavani - Known for his luxurious gowns and the signature "Valentino Red," he is a staple in haute couture fashion.

Legendary Italian Sports Figures

Sports are an integral part of Italian culture, and several athletes have achieved legendary status:

  • Roberto Baggio - A football icon, Baggio is remembered for his incredible skill and contributions to the Italian national team.
  • Valentino Rossi - A MotoGP legend, Rossi's career has made him one of the most recognized figures in motorcycle racing.
  • Francesco Totti - A symbol of loyalty and excellence, Totti spent his entire football career with AS Roma, earning accolades as one of the greatest players of his generation.
